Cairns Tours has enjoyed significant growth in the twenty one years of operation. The company’s increasing success is reflected in their workforce, which has grown and flourished from 18 in 1990, to 125 in 2011.
Cairns Tours sets itself apart from competitors with a fleet of 56 luxury vehicles ranging from 20-seat Toyota Coasters to 53-seater touring coaches, as well as a specialised wheelchair-equipped vehicle.

Kuranda, Self-Drive, Scenic Rail up & Skyrail down: Spend 2.5 hours or 4.5 hours in Kuranda. In the morning drive your car the Skyrail Station at Smithfield, a 20 minute drive North of Cairns city. Park and meet the coach here at 9:10am. Park here for the day is no charge. A coach will transfer you from Skyrail Smithfield car park to Freshwater Connection Railway Station. Journey to Kuranda by Train then have free time in Kuranda. At a pre-booked time head to the Skyrail Kuranda Station and journey back down the mountain.
